- Tawara_gaeshi abstract "Tawara Gaeshi (俵返) is one of the preserved throwing techniques, Habukareta Waza, of Judo. It belonged to the fourth group, Dai Yonkyo, of the 1895 Gokyo no Waza lists.It is categorized as a rear sacrifice technique, Ma-sutemi.".
